Autopromotec 2025, the automotive equipment fair is underway

Bologna, 21 May 2025 – Ribbon cutting at Autopromotec , the biennial exhibition inaugurated today and which will last until Saturday 24 May , specialising in automotive equipment and aftermarket products and which will celebrate the sixtieth anniversary of its foundation in 2025.
"The future is now – commented Renzo Servadei , CEO of Autopromotec –. I'll give you an example: when phones changed, with the transition from physical buttons to screens , it seemed like nothing had changed. Instead, this changed our lives. Well, in the automotive industry it's the same thing".
In fact, "once vehicles were designed starting from the mechanics , now the software is designed first. This is why they are vehicles connected to the user, to services, to workshops and less polluting", says Servadei.
Artificial intelligence is the key to this 30th edition: "A provocation: AI helps designers speed up the process, but in the end it takes a lot of vision and creativity to be able to put together the future. The most important thing will be to have 'zero accidents'" , he claims.
